larval A10f neuron [FBbt_00111254]
Neuron of the larval abdominal neuromere that is part of lineage 10. Its primary neurite extends dorsomedially arborizing across the midline, with both dendritic and axonal domains extending anteroposteriorly. It receives input from Basin-2 (Ohyama et al., 2015). This is a nociceptive integrator neuron, i.e. it is a node of convergence for multiple neurons carrying nociceptive information (Burgos et al., 2018).
